Western Digital Corporation engages in the development, manufacture, and sale of data storage devices and solutions based on hard disk drive (HDD) technology in the United States, Asia,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company offers internal HDDs, data center drives, data center platforms, external drives, portable drives, NAS for home and office, and accessories. It sells its data storage devices and solutions through its computer sales personnel, dealers, distributors, retailers, and subsidiaries. The company has a collaboration with Open Quantum Design for the development of quantum error correction technology and related systems to advance reliable quantum computing. Western Digital Corporation was founded in 1970 and is headquartered in San Jose, California.
